Warning Signs You Need Emergency Water Extraction

Catching water damage early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show mold growth. If you notice a musty smell in your property, don’t ignore it.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and take steps to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, contact our team immediately. We’ll assess the situation and provide a plan to repair or replace your flooring.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ains on walls or ceilings can show a leak or water intrusion. If you notice any water stains, don’t wait.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and take steps to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your paint or wallpaper, contact our team immediately. We’ll assess the situation and provide a plan to repair or replace your walls.

Discoloration or Warping of Wood

Discoloration or warping of wood can show water damage. If you notice any changes in your wood surfaces, don’t ignore it. Our team can help you identify the source of the damage and take steps to prevent further damage.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can show a problem with your plumbing or HVAC system.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, contact our team immediately. We’ll assess the situation and provide a plan to repair or replace your system.

Emergency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a bathroom Yes No You can likely fix a small leak yourself with some basic plumbing knowledge.
Large flood in a basement No Yes A large flood needs specialized equipment and expertise to extract the water and dry the space.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es A burst pipe needs immediate attention to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.
Musty odors in a crawlspace No Yes Musty odors in a crawlspace can show mold growth, which needs professional attention to remove and prevent further damage.
Water stains on walls or ceilings No Yes Water stains on walls or ceilings can show a leak or water intrusion, which needs professional attention to identify and repair the source.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, which needs professional attention to repair or replace the flooring.

Emergency Water Extraction Cost In Verona, MS

The cost of Emergency Water Extraction services in Verona, MS can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ing your property. Keep in mind that prices may range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the job.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ed
Cleaning and disinfection $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of surfaces affected
Restoration and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ials needed, complexity of job
Equipment rental and usage $100 – $500 Type of equipment needed, rental duration
Inspection and ass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of job
Permits and inspections $50 – $200 Local regulations and requirements

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on the specifics of your job.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ing your property.
